Medical Instrument Technician (Electroencephalography) - Up to 10K Recruitment/Relocation Incentive
Electroencephalograph (EEG) Technicians operate EEG equipment as well as other recording devices for such studies as electromyography (EMG), nerve conduction studies (NCS) and evoked potentials (EP). Technicians perform EEG, NCS and EPs to record electrical activity of the brain, spinal cord, peripheral nerves and muscles.
